Default Buying first cart Sunday. Confused about serial number

Thanks for checking me out. Love this site. Confused about the serial number. The letters seem to be backwards from the guides I have seen posted. Any insight? The batteries are 2 years old. Can't wait! Getting it for $1000.00. That seems fair to me.

Default Re: Buying first cart Sunday. Confused about serial number

QP stands for Pathway Cart. I can tell you this, that is NOT a Pathway Cart and it looks like someone put the serial # sticker that is on there now over the existing serial # sticker. The cart does have Speed Code 4 installed and will go 19.6 mph.

Granted $1000.00 is still a pretty good deal, but the tag concerns me!
If you can, check the other tag under the dash panel,
pop the screw covers, and just loosen the 2 screws on either side, (don't remove them!)
pull the dash panel a way a bit and you'll see the other tag!

I forgot... it's a sparky!
Before you pull the dash panel and check the other tag,
put the tow/run switch in tow, and then disconnect the main positive battery cable!

When sparks fly on an electric cart... it may lead to disaster!
